Mike Maples on Investing in Airbnb and the Evolution of Social Networking
Mike Maples, Managing Partner of Floodgate, shares his insights on investing in Airbnb and the growth of social networking platforms. Despite passing on an initial opportunity to invest in Airbnb, Maples now sees the company as having "thunder lizard potential" and believes it can achieve a defensible advantage through network effects. He also discusses his views on Google Plus, Twitter, and Facebook, and shares his thoughts on how the social networking landscape is evolving.
